Roofers install and repair roofing systems in commercial buildings. They work at a variety settings, including medical facilities, warehouses, and offices.
Common roofing issues include leaks, deterioration and damage caused by inclement weather. The best way of preventing these issues is by inspecting your roof on a regular basis. This will allow you to spot problems early on and avoid costly repairs in the future.
Leaks can be caused by a variety of factors.

How to choose a contractor:
To find the perfect commercial roofer you will need do some research, and interview a few different companies. You should ask about their experience, qualifications and pricing. This will help you make an informed decision about which company is right for your project. You should also check to see if they offer a warranty on their work and whether or not they are licensed.
